Karnataka will go to elections in May. Home Minister Amit Shah had said that PM Modi will be the face of the party going into the elections.
The Bharatiya Janata Party in Karnataka began its election drive on a cautious note.
It was hounded with problems with allegations of corruption, demonstrations by the Panchamshali Lingayats, just to name a few.

The face of the party in the run up to the elections was also a debated one with many raising questions whether chief minister Basavaraj Bommai could lead the election campaign.
